A. Prequel
The following passages detail the history and origin of the vast desert region known as Iro. It is confirmed that this desert is not infact part of this dimension, but of another with such subtle boundaries to our own that the worlds seem connected. The passages will first and foremost detail history and major events, but will also go into surface details about important figures in the desert's history and lightly brush the desert's basic beastiaries.

I. Legendary Origins

A note: Scholars on the subject are very split about wether the origins of the desert's oldest races are true or fallacious. These differences largely rise between the fact that many of the scholars are highly religious, while others are faithless.

As story has it, the very first traces of life in the desert were large, predatory insects. These were classified as early as we had the knowlege to be highly intelligent. They are highly territorial, hunt in packs and have been known to create traps for their prey.

Not long after these creatures began surfacing, a strange, seemingly mixed breed of fox and dragon known as the Arutal began creating settlements that dotted large parts of the western desert. Over time, these creatures rapidly evolved and advanced, forming all their dotted villages into a vast empire known as Traunus. The Arutal achieved very unusual levels of technology and evolution in their time. Basic clockwork appendages were exceedingly common, and the Arutal actually evolved to have mana in their natural composition. They were, however, very corrupted by the immense amount of power they wield. The emperor of Traunus, Kahaijus I, ordered that an object of divine power be crafted, to be given to the emperor and passed down the line so that the Arutal may be ruled and lead by the power of the gods. Their foolery with divine forces attracted the attention of an extra-planar demon king. The only solace the Arutal could find was that this demon king was unable to, on his own power, move from his dimension to theirs. He did, however, have powerful agents who set the empire ablaze, destroying the vast, powerful civilization of the Arutal and all it's recorded members in the course of three days. The half-completed object that contained the imperfect power of the gods was lost to the sands, it is said that the demon king searches for this lost power to this day.

It is interesting to note that following the empire's fall, undead have become a 'natural' part of Iro's wild'life'. It is suspected that the vast amount of dark energy used against the Arutal, and the mass amount of mana that was absorbed into the desert sands from their deaths, is responsible for this change.

II. Amitus and Garuda

It is said that the Amitus wolves, a race of wolves who's primary characteristics are unusual tolerance to incredible heat and an unusually large stature, and the Garuda, a race of metallic avians, were created in the image of the land's god, Xoenn, known by both races as 'Judgement'. These races did not live at peace for a long time, war and destruction littered the first three hundred years of their existance. It was not until the end of those long, bloody years that a child was born of a wolven mother and a garudan father. This birth, and the union of the mother and father, was enough to finally bring the two races together in peace, how they continued to live for many, many years after.

Note: Regardless of the union, the most mixed-bloodlines that occured at the same time was three. And by the turn of the age, there was only one. This was a subject of great concern for many years, because the union of the race's bloods was still considered what held the races together, and those of mixed blood were considered of the highest nobility.

III. The age of the lich

It was only a matter of time before a being of dark power would see opportunity in the natural, incredibly sustainable ranks of undead that could be found wandering the desert. A lich of terrible power took the reigns of the legions, and raised many more. The lich enslaved the proud garudan people, and would proceed to launch a five-year war against the wolves of Amitus. The war lasted so long because it was well-matched. The ranks of both sides were thick, and there was a terrible clash of holy and unholy magic, the power of the lich and his necromancers against the power of the grand vizier of the continental army and the holy order of paladins under his command.

This war ended when six wolves, an exiled sergeant and the five loyal men who had followed him, stormed feverishly through the vast distances and arrived at the lich's fortress. They fought like men possessed and reached the lich's chamber to meet him in the final conflict. All but the sergeant were killed in that last fight, and both of the remaining combatants were terribly wounded. The dark one faded first, and the sergeant picked up his sword and wandered out into the desert, expecting and satisfied with the thought of death after such meaning was brought to his life.

A year after the war ended, a new power took hold in the desert.. This one far darker and more ancient than the lich. This new evil gathered the lich's remaining forces together, and with astonishing force and speed, completely levelled the city in the space of a single night. Nobody who was in Amitus that night survived.

IV. Today

It is unsure what will happen now. It is rumored that there are small pockets of both races still trying to hold their own and rebuild against the tide of evil that remains in Iro today, but there is no hard evidence that any members of the garudan race are still alive, and there is only one Amitus wolf left that can be accounted for.

The last known Garuda, Horus Valkar, was assassinated by an agent of obscure employment in Lismore.
